Bhimbar

Bhimbar is a village located in Keshpur subdivision of Paschim Medinipur district in West Bengal, India. It is situated 23.5km away from sub-district headquarter Keshpur. Midnapur is the district headquarter of Bhimbar village. As per 2009 stats, Enayetpur is the gram panchayat of Bhimbar village.

About Bhimbar

According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Bhimbar is 338562. The village spans a total geographical area of 66.64 hectares, and the pincode of the locality is 721156. Midnapore is nearest town to Bhimbar village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 42km away.

Population of Bhimbar

Below is a concise population overview of Bhimbar as per the Census 2011 data. The table highlights the key population metrics categorized by gender and social groups.

ParticularsTotalMaleFemale
Total Population 331 161 170
Child Population (0–6 yrs) 53 29 24
Scheduled Castes (SC) N/A N/A N/A
Scheduled Tribes (ST) 11 4 7
Literate Population 198 107 91
Illiterate Population 133 54 79

Here's a detailed summary of the Basic Population Details of Bhimbar village:

  • The total population of Bhimbar village is around 331, including approximately 161 males and 170 females, with a sex ratio of 1055 females per 1,000 males.
  • There are about 53 children aged 0–6 years in Bhimbar village, reflecting the young population in the village.
  • Bhimbar village has 11 residents from the Scheduled Tribes (ST).
  • The literacy rate of Bhimbar village is about 59.82%, with male literacy at 66.46% and female literacy at 53.53%.
  • There are around 77 households in Bhimbar village.

Connectivity of Bhimbar

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Bhimbar. As per the 2011 stats, Bhimbar had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.

Connectivity Type Status (in year 2011)
Public Bus Service Available within <5 km distance
Private Bus Service Available within <5 km distance
Railway Station Available within 10+ km distance
